We're proud to show what's possible when people who care deeply about healthcare, and about each other, build something meaningful together.Position SummaryWe are seeking a self-motivated Field EEG Technologist/Technician for Full-Time or Per Diem (PRN) opportunities in the Salt Lake City, Utah area. This position requires daily travel to patients' homes and clinical sites to deploy ambulatory and video EEG monitoring equipment, bringing Synthesys Brain Health's diagnostic services directly to the patients who need them.Key ResponsibilitiesPerform EEG procedures in accordance with Synthesys Brain Health policies and procedures, ensuring electrode application adheres to the International 10–20 SystemTravel daily to patients' homes and clinical sites to deploy and manage ambulatory and video EEG monitoring equipmentMaintain patient safety throughout clinical and non-clinical events, communicating with other patient care support staff as neededRecognize clinically significant events and follow company policy regarding critical test resultsCorrelate patient history and clinical symptoms to determine appropriate electrode application and recording parameters for conditions including seizure classification, stroke, trauma, encephalopathy, and altered consciousnessApply working knowledge of medication effects on EEG background and waveforms, medical terminology, and EEG correlates for adult and pediatric neurological, seizure, and psychiatric/psychological disordersFollow technical criteria for recording neonatal and pediatric EEGs, and recognize normal, normal variant, and abnormal awake/asleep patterns across age rangesCommunicate effectively with patients and staff, explaining the purpose of the EEG procedure and answering questionsIdentify and perform basic and intermediate technical troubleshooting and artifact identification/eliminationMaintain correct electrode connections and apply knowledge of alternate montages, protocols, and equipment settingsFollow concepts of digital equipment and electrical safety within the EEG unitPerform patient assessment related to care, including electrode fixation product allergies, movement restrictions, and cognitive functionComplete required technical EEG reporting and patient logging per Synthesys Brain Health policyPrepare and supply patient rooms/sites for EEG proceduresContact supervisory staff as appropriate regarding problems within the EEG unitContinue to learn and apply basic and intermediate EEG waveform recognition, relevant anatomy, physiology, infection control, current HIPAA practices, contraindications for activation procedures, and instrumentation preparationPerform other related duties consistent with patient and technical care for this levelCompensation & BenefitsThis role is available as Full-Time or Per Diem (PRN), with a pay range of $25.00 – $35.00 per hour, dependent on experience.For All Employees (Full-Time & PRN):Employee Assistance Program (EAP): Comprehensive mental health, financial guidance, and wellness support from day oneExclusive Full-Time (FTE) Benefits:Company Vehicle: No wear and tear on your personal car — a company car is provided for your daily field travelComprehensive Health Benefits: Robust medical, dental, and vision insurance packages.
